WebDec 11, 2024 · This can get to the level of the manager standing over your shoulders as you work. That is a sign of bad management. Instead of recognizing employees as members of a team, fighting towards a common goal, micromanagers think of employees as cogs in a machine. This results in a lack of trust between employees and the managers. Web2 days ago · Jason Henry for The New York Times.
